package proxyscraper
import (
"github.com/texnicii/proxy-scraper/parser/proxy"
"reflect"
"testing"
)
func TestCollectUniq(t *testing.T) {
a := proxy.Proxy{
Ipv4: "0.0.0.0",
Port: 0,
ProxyType: "0",
}
b := proxy.Proxy{
Ipv4: "1.0.0.0",
Port: 0,
ProxyType: "0",
}
//is not uniq by ip address with "a"
c := proxy.Proxy{
Ipv4: "0.0.0.0",
Port: 0,
ProxyType: "1",
}
type args struct {
inputData []proxy.Proxy
errorCh <-chan error
debug bool
}
tests := []struct {
name string
args args
want map[string]proxy.Proxy
}{
{
name: "Two uniq elements write to channel",
args: args{
inputData: []proxy.Proxy{a, b},
errorCh: nil,
debug: false,
},
want: map[string]proxy.Proxy{
"0.0.0.0": a,
"1.0.0.0": b,
},
},
{
name: "Two uniq elements write to channel",
args: args{
inputData: []proxy.Proxy{a, c},
errorCh: nil,
debug: false,
},
want: map[string]proxy.Proxy{
"0.0.0.0": a,
},
},
}
for _, tt := range tests {
t.Run(tt.name, func(t *testing.T) {
inputCh := make(chan []proxy.Proxy)
go func() {
inputCh <- tt.args.inputData
close(inputCh)
}()
if got := CollectUniq(inputCh, nil, tt.args.debug); !reflect.DeepEqual(got, tt.want) {
t.Errorf("CollectUniq() = %v, want %v", got, tt.want)
}
})
}
}
